Etymology[edit]

chatter +‎ -ish

Adjective[edit]

chatterish (comparative more chatterish, superlative most chatterish)

  1. somewhat chattery
    • 1939, Leo Richard Ward, God in an Irish kitchen[1]:
      "The two of them take the world with a great ease, and are not chatterish."
